WebFoam can be a sign that there are proteins present in your urine. This is known as proteinuria, which indicates that the kidneys are not functioning properly. Kidneys normally function by filtering out excess water and waste products from the blood and into your urine (Watson, 2024). WebThis could be caused by a number of diseases that directly impact the kidneys, such as lupus or diabetes, but can also be a symptom of a medical issue affecting other systems in your body.
